Renishaw introduces dual-method gauging system
TodayRenishaw has announced the launch of its latest solution for shop floor process control, the Equator-X 500 dual-method system. This enables manufacturers to select the optimum inspection method, Absolute or Compare, for their process challenge, effectively deploying two systems in one.

Plain bearing materials are now PTFE-free
3 days agoigus has announced a breakthrough for greener bearings: polymer plain bearings of the iglidur G, X and H ranges, which are used in machines, systems and vehicles worldwide, are now available PTFE free. This is great news for many companies that are anticipating stricter PFAS/PTFE regulations or even a ban and are looking for reliable alternatives.
